Meaning, origin, history

Ennice is a unique and charming name with an interesting history and meaning. It originates from the French name Anise, which means "anise seed" in English. The name Anise comes from the Latin word "anisum," which refers to the spice obtained from the seeds of the anise plant. The name Ennice is a variant spelling of Anise, with the addition of the letter 'e' at the beginning. This variation could have been introduced over time as a way to differentiate it from other names that sound similar or have the same meaning but are spelled differently. There is no extensive history behind the name Ennice itself, as it is not one of the most common names throughout history. However, its roots can be traced back to ancient times through the French name Anise and ultimately to the Latin word "anisum."
